OPEN ACCESS REPOSITORIES IN NIGERIAN LIBRARIES
ISSUES AND CHALLENGES

This paper discussed issues and challenges involved in the management of open access repositories in Nigerian libraries. Open access repository concerns the archiving of a research report or book written into a database belonging to an institution. This platform allows free access and exchange of ideas without subscriptions. The era of publishing in closed access is gradually being phased out with the emergence of Information and Communication Technologies (ICTs). This new media form has enabled gathering together of already published works by an institution, on an institution and its staff into a database called institutional repository. Expectedly, this synergy has numerous advantages amongst which is free access and exchange of knowledge. This in turn promotes web visibility and global university ranking. This paper thus highlights software that enhances open access repositories, types of open access repositories, advantages, challenges, as well as strategies that can be adopted to enhance open access repositories in Nigerian libraries.
